
BỘ LAO ĐỘNG – THƯƠNG BINH VÀ XÃ HỘI
TRƯỜNG ĐẠI HỌC LAO ĐỘNG – XÃ HỘI
Ban biên soạn:
1. Chủ biên: Th.S. Tạ Tường Vi
Th.S. Nguyễn Thanh Huyền
2. Thành viên: Th.S. Nguyễn Hữu Bình
Th.S. Bùi Thị Hồng Dung
Th.S. Nguyễn Nam Thắng
BÀI GIẢNG
TIN HỌC CƠ BẢN 2
(Dùng cho trình độ đại học)
TÀI LIỆU LƯU HÀNH NỘI BỘ
Hà Nội, 2021

Bài giảng Tin học cơ bản II
3
LỜI NÓI ĐẦU
Tin học cơ bản 2 là học phần được giảng dạy cho sinh viên tất cả các ngành
không phải Công nghệ thông tin tại trường Đại học Lao động Xã hội. Mục tiêu của
học phần là trang bị cho sinh viên kiến thức và kỹ năng làm việc với cơ sở dữ liệu trên
nền tảng của hệ quản trị cơ sở dữ liệu Microsoft Access. Microsoft Access là hệ quản
trị cơ sở dữ liệu quan hệ (relational database management system) cho phép phát triển
nhanh những giải pháp lưu trữ và quản lý thông tin (RAD – Rapid Application
Development), thuận lợi để phát triển các hệ thống quản trị thông tin dành cho các
doanh nghiệp vừa và nhỏ hoặc quản trị dữ liệu trong một số mảng của doanh nghiệp
lớn.
Nhằm mục đích phục vụ cho việc giảng dạy và học tập học phần Tin học cơ bản
2 trong Trường Đại học Lao động Xã hội, nhóm tác giả chúng tôi biên soạn bài giảng
này để giới thiệu phiên bản Microsoft Access 2016, kế thừa và phát huy các nội dung
của Microsoft Access phiên bản 2010.
Bài giảng này bao gồm 05 chương và 03 phụ lục:
Chương 1: Tổng quan về hệ quản trị cơ sở dữ liệu Microsoft Access
Chương 2: Bảng dữ liệu (table)
Chương 3: Truy vấn (Query)
Chương 4: Mẫu biểu (Form)
Chương 5: Báo biểu (Report)
Phụ lục 1: danh mục các bảng biểu.
Phụ lục 2: danh mục các hình vẽ.
Phụ lục 3: đáp án cho phần câu hỏi trắc nghiệm và hướng dẫn trả lời câu hỏi ôn
tập chương.
Để biên soạn cuốn bài giảng này, chúng tôi đã kết hợp kiến thức và kinh nghiệm
giảng dạy của mình nhằm giúp sinh viên có thể dễ dàng nắm bắt được kiến thức môn
học. Mặc dù rất cố gắng trong quá trình biên soạn, nhưng chắc chắn không thể tránh
khỏi một số thiếu sót, vì vậy, chúng tôi rất mong nhận được ý kiến đóng góp của bạn
đọc để bài giảng ngày càng hoàn thiện hơn.
Hà Nội, 12/2021
BỘ MÔN CÔNG NGHỆ THÔNG TIN
TRƯỜNG ĐẠI HỌC LAO ĐỘNG - XÃ HỘI

Bài giảng Tin học cơ bản II
4
MỤC LỤC
LỜI NÓI ĐẦU ................................................................................................................2
CHƯƠNG 1: TỔNG QUAN VỀ HỆ QUẢN TRỊ CƠ SỞ DỮ LIỆU MICROSOFT
ACCESS .........................................................................................................................8
1.1. KHÁI NIỆM ...........................................................................................................8
1.2. GIỚI THIỆU MICROSOFT ACCESS 2016 .......................................................8
1.3. BẮT ĐẦU LÀM VIỆC VỚI MICROSOFT ACCESS ......................................10
1.3.1. Khởi động Microsoft Access ...............................................................................10
1.3.2. Giao diện ban đầu ................................................................................................11
1.3.3. Các mẫu có sẵn (Templates) trong Access 2016 .................................................13
1.3.4. Một số tùy chỉnh định dạng ................................................................................13
1.4. LÀM VIỆC VỚI CƠ SỞ DỮ LIỆU MICROSOFT ACCESS .........................15
1.4.1. Tạo cơ sở dữ liệu mới .........................................................................................15
1.4.2. Mở một cơ sở dữ liệu đã có sẵn ..........................................................................17
1.4.3. Lưu CSDL hiện hành với phiên bản Access khác ...............................................20
1.4.4. Giao diện làm việc ..............................................................................................21
1.4.5. Các đối tượng trong cơ sở dữ liệu Access ..........................................................23
1.4.6. Import các đối tượng trong CSDL .......................................................................27
1.4.7. Đóng một cơ sở dữ liệu đang mở và thoát khỏi Access ......................................28
CÂU HỎI ÔN TẬP ......................................................................................................29
CHƯƠNG 2: BẢNG DỮ LIỆU (TABLE) ............................................................32
Đặc biệt là qui trình xây dựng một CSDL Access ....................................................32
2.1. KHÁI NIỆM ..........................................................................................................32
2.1.1. Xây dựng cơ sở dữ liệu trong Microsoft Access .................................................32
2.1.2. Bảng dữ liệu .........................................................................................................34
2.1.3. Liên kết giữa các bảng trong cơ sở dữ liệu .........................................................37
2.2. TẠO BẢNG ...........................................................................................................39
2.2.1. Tạo bảng bằng phương pháp Datasheet view ......................................................39
2.2.2. Tạo bảng bằng phương pháp Design view ..........................................................42
2.2.3. Sử dụng LOOKUP WIZARD .............................................................................56
2.2.4 Qui trình tạo bảng .................................................................................................59
2.3. THAO TÁC TRÊN BẢNG ..................................................................................59
2.3.1. Hiệu chỉnh một bảng ...........................................................................................59
2.3.2. Thao tác với dữ liệu bảng ....................................................................................65
2.4. IN ẤN BẢNG ........................................................................................................73
A. CÂU HỎI ÔN TẬP .................................................................................................74
B. BÀI TẬP CỦNG CỐ KIẾN THỨC ......................................................................78

Bài giảng Tin học cơ bản II
5
CHƯƠNG 3. TRUY VẤN (QUERY) .........................................................................81
3.1. KHÁI NIỆM ..........................................................................................................81
3.1.1. Truy vấn ...............................................................................................................81
3.1.2. Các loại truy vấn ..................................................................................................81
3.2 TRUY VẤN LỰA CHỌN (SELECT QUERY) ..................................................82
3.2.1 Tạo Simple query .................................................................................................82
3.2.2. Tạo Select query bằng Design view ....................................................................84
3.2.3 Các thành phần trong cửa sổ thiết kế truy vấn .....................................................87
3.2.4 Các thao tác trong cửa sổ thiết kế truy vấn ..........................................................87
3.2.5 Cách nhập biểu thức điều kiện .............................................................................89
3.2.6 Sắp xếp và lọc dữ liệu trong truy vấn ...................................................................91
3.2.7 Tạo trường tính toán trong truy vấn .....................................................................95
3.3 TRUY VẤN TỔNG (TOTAL QUERY) ..............................................................97
3.3.1. Cách tạo Total query ...........................................................................................98
3.3.2 Các tùy chọn trên dòng Total ...............................................................................99
3.4 TRUY VẤN CHÉO (CROSSTAB QUERY) .......................................................99
3.4.1 Tạo Crosstab query bằng Query Wizard ........................................................... 100
3.4.2 Tạo Crosstab query bằng Design view .............................................................. 103
3.5 TRUY VẤN HÀNH ĐỘNG (ACTION QUERY) ............................................ 105
3.5.1 Truy vấn tạo bảng (Make-Table query) ............................................................ 105
3.5.2 Truy vấn cập nhật (Update query) ..................................................................... 107
3.5.3 Truy vấn bổ sung bản ghi (Append query) ........................................................ 108
3.5.4. Truy vấn xóa bản ghi (Delete query) ................................................................ 111
CÂU HỎI ÔN TẬP ................................................................................................... 113
BÀI TẬP CỦNG CỐ KIẾN THỨC ........................................................................ 116
CHƯƠNG 4. BIỂU MẪU (FORM) ......................................................................... 120
4.1 GIỚI THIỆU VỀ BIỂU MẪU ........................................................................... 120
4.1.1 Khái niệm về biểu mẫu ...................................................................................... 120
4.1.2 Công dụng của biểu mẫu ................................................................................... 120
4.1.3 Kết cấu của biểu mẫu ........................................................................................ 120
4.2 THIẾT KẾ BIỂU MẪU ..................................................................................... 121
4.2.1 Thiết kế biểu mẫu dùng nút lệnh Form (Single Form) ...................................... 122
4.2.2 Thiết kế biểu mẫu dùng Form Wizard ............................................................. 122
4.2.3. Thiết kế biểu mẫu dùng Form Design .............................................................. 124
4.3 CÁC CHẾ ĐỘ HIỂN THỊ BIỂU MẪU ........................................................... 126
4.3.1. Form View ........................................................................................................ 126
4.3.2. Layout View .................................................................................................... 126

Bài giảng Tin học cơ bản II
6
4.3.3. Design View .................................................................................................... 126
4.4. CÁC THAO TÁC TRÊN BIỂU MẪU ............................................................. 127
4.4.1. Tìm kiếm và chỉnh sửa một bản ghi (Record) .................................................. 127
4.4.2. Thêm mới một bản ghi (Record) ...................................................................... 128
4.4.3. Xóa một bản ghi (Record) ................................................................................ 128
4.4.4. Lọc dữ liệu trên Form ....................................................................................... 128
4.5 CHỈNH SỬA VÀ TRÌNH BÀY BIỂU MẪU ................................................... 129
4.5.1 Chèn các điều khiển thuộc nhóm lệnh Controls vào Form ............................... 129
4.5.2. Các loại Form Control ...................................................................................... 130
4.5.3. Tinh chỉnh Form (chế độ Design View). .......................................................... 132
4.5.4. Cách tạo các control có hỗ trợ của chức năng Wizard ..................................... 136
4.6. BIỂU MẪU VÀ CÁC BẢNG LIÊN KẾT ....................................................... 142
4.6.1. Subform Control ............................................................................................... 142
4.6.2. Tab Control ....................................................................................................... 145
4.6.4. Liên kết đến dữ liệu quan hệ (Link to Related Data) ....................................... 148
CÂU HỎI ÔN TẬP ................................................................................................... 151
BÀI TẬP CỦNG CỐ KIẾN THỨC ........................................................................ 152
CHƯƠNG 5. BÁO BIỂU (REPORT) ..................................................................... 157
5.1. TỔNG QUAN VỀ BÁO BIỂU.......................................................................... 157
5.1.1. Khái niệm ......................................................................................................... 157
5.1.2. Các loại báo biểu .............................................................................................. 157
5.1.3 Các chế độ hiển thị báo biểu .............................................................................. 158
5.2. THIẾT KẾ BÁO BIỂU ..................................................................................... 158
5.2.1 Cấu trúc báo biểu ............................................................................................... 158
5.2.2. Môi trường làm việc ......................................................................................... 160
5.2.3. Thiết kế báo biểu .............................................................................................. 160
5.3. HIỆU CHỈNH BÁO BIỂU Ở CHẾ ĐỘ DESIGN VIEW .............................. 171
5.3.1. Chèn một số điều khiển thuộc nhóm lệnh Controls vào Report ....................... 171
5.3.2. Các loại Report Control .................................................................................... 171
5.3.3. Đưa các trường còn thiếu vào Report ............................................................... 173
5.3.4. Các thao tác chỉnh sửa điều khiển (Control) .................................................... 174
5.3.5. Định dạng Report ............................................................................................. 176
5.3.6. Dùng các định dạng có sẵn Themes ................................................................. 179
5.4. TẠO BÁO BIỂU CÓ PHÂN NHÓM ............................................................... 180
5.4.1. Sử dụng Total Query ........................................................................................ 180
5.4.2.Report Grouping ................................................................................................ 182
5.4.3.Tạo Report có phân nhóm bằng wizard ............................................................. 184

